May 2, 1775 The recantations of a number of person from Marblehead, which were accepted by the Committee of Safety. Of note, Benjamin Marston signed one of these recantations; however, he fled to Nova Scotia in 1776, and remained a Loyalist throughout the war. See LLMC #39563 for a related document.
